Del Mar Race No. 3 (7 p.m. ET/4 p.m.PT)
#2 Fort Moultrie (5-2)
Trainer Phil D’Amato doesn’t claim many these days, but he took this Midwest-based invader for $50,000 in May and, in a sign of confidence, returns him protected in this starter allowance grass miler with plenty of ship-and-win money on the table. A steady, healthy series of workouts should have this gelding fit and ready and with top jockey Juan Hernandez signing on, we’re expecting this 4-year-old gelding to be along in time.
Del Mar Race No. 5 (8 p.m. ET/5 p.m. PT)
#3 True Patriot (3-1)
This daughter of Clubhouse Ride shows the classic two-sprints-and-a-stretch-out pattern and seems certain to improve in this one mile turf affair for California-bred older fillies and mares. Second in both prior outings sprinting on grass at Santa Anita during the spring, she gives every indication that added distance will bring out her best, and from a nice inside draw the Carla Gaines-trained sophomore projects to settle into a good stalking position and then have every chance to seal the deal when asked to quicken at the head of the lane.
